Output 5457ae0393778b8cf106d1997cacc341fa50c1354fa193c8c18a153185a9b029:143

value
4226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24b7a26beb8d3be36e7667d817ae4b7f28d7d7e OP_EQUAL
address
3Pn9sDD3L9zvbBABuDnAN5qbjJvYMyxJVA
transaction
5457ae0393778b8cf106d1997cacc341fa50c1354fa193c8c18a153185a9b029
spent
true